Output 24ba47a8fec8aebe5447ec8c1bc68a3c409c2d998ee3a767c0c5b6e5a39b84cd:1

value
1080951603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7181d6b880f61580e9af25f2cefe0d227fceeaa1 OP_EQUAL
address
3C3BpaKXqYdfUxYYsiTiax64UPKySU6aNU
transaction
24ba47a8fec8aebe5447ec8c1bc68a3c409c2d998ee3a767c0c5b6e5a39b84cd
spent
true